erval Wildlife Sanctuary is the perfect short excursion from Moshi or Arusha, located in Sanya Juu, Siha District of the Kilimanjaro Region—just one hour from Moshi and 90 minutes from Arusha. This incredible sanctuary offers visitors a rare and unforgettable opportunity to interact closely with a variety of rescued and protected animals in a safe, ethical, and beautifully maintained environment. It’s an ideal day trip or overnight escape for travelers looking to experience Tanzania’s unique wildlife up close.

During your visit, you’ll have the chance to feed and take photos with animals such as African lions, Masai giraffes, colobus monkeys, vervet monkeys, elands, bat-eared foxes, and ostriches. The sanctuary is home to over 3,000 hand-planted endemic trees, creating a lush and natural environment where wildlife thrives. Our experienced guides and animal keepers will lead you through the sanctuary, offering fascinating insights into animal behavior, conservation efforts, and the story behind each resident animal.
